Soren Shieldbreaker is a free folk leader.[1]
Character
Soren is a famed warrior who wields an axe. He has at least one son.[1]
Recent Events
A Dance with Dragons
Soren Shieldbreaker is among the wildling leaders who accompany Tormund Giantsbane to the Wall in declaring a truce with the Night's Watch. His son, a tall lad, is made a hostage of the Night's Watch to guarantee the peace between the wildlings and the Watch.[1]
Soren is given the abandoned castle Stonedoor by Jon Snow, the new Lord Commander of the Night's Watch, to garrison and settle his own people.[2] He is present in the Shieldhall when Jon announces the letter purportedly from Ramsay Bolton entitled 'Bastard', and he stands when Jon asks for volunteers.[2]
Quotes
Soren's axe is yours, Jon Snow, if ever you have need of such.[1]
—Soren to Jon Snow
